Entity | Description |
Disability Support Services | Comprehensive supports for individuals with disabilities, funded by NDIS. |
Disability Services Provider | Organizations that deliver a range of disability supports and programs. |
Support at Home Provider | Services offering assistance within the home to promote independence. |
Disability Support Coordination | Helping clients manage their NDIS plans and connect with appropriate providers. |
Respite Care Provider | Temporary care services that provide relief to primary carers of disabled individuals. |

Understanding the process of engaging with an NDIS registered provider can ease the journey for many participants. Here’s how EnableU Western Sydney works to provide dependable, efficient support services:
We start by listening carefully to your goals and challenges. Our specialists help assess your current capabilities and identify areas where support or therapy can improve your quality of life.
Based on your assessment, we develop customised care plans incorporating disability support and therapeutic interventions such as physiotherapy or occupational therapy. These plans align precisely with your NDIS funding and personal objectives.
Our team visits your residence, providing personalized assistance such as personal care, daily living support, mobility aid, and allied health treatments. Being locally-based allows us to promptly respond to your evolving needs.
We regularly review and adapt your service plan to ensure maximum effectiveness and satisfaction. Open communication keeps participants confident that their goals remain front and center.
